20150085470 | OPTICAL SHEET, SURFACE LIGHT SOURCE DEVICE AND TRANSMISSION TYPE DISPLAY DEVICE - There is provided an optical sheet which can prevent problems when it is superimposed on another member. The optical sheet includes: a sheet-like base layer; a light control layer having unit shaped elements arranged in a direction parallel to a sheet surface of the base layer; and a light diffusing layer disposed between the base layer and the light control layer. The light diffusing layer includes a binder resin portion and particles dispersed in the binder resin portion. The particles in the binder resin portion include a single particle and an aggregate formed of aggregated single particles. | 03-26-2015 |
